Physical Bauxite Processing: Crushing and Grinding of Bauxite

2022.1.1  The first crushing of the bauxite may often take place at the mine before transport to the alumina refinery if located nearby, or to the shipping port for export. At the refinery further crushing and/or washing may take place before the crushed bauxite is subjected to a grinding operation for final sizing before digestion. This chapter present ...

Bauxite - an overview ScienceDirect Topics

2015.6.1  Bauxite is a reddish-brown clay-like deposit containing iron, silicates and aluminium oxides, the latter comprising the largest constituents. At present, bauxite is so plentiful that only deposits containing a content of aluminium oxides greater than 45% are selected to manufacture aluminium. Effect of bauxite aggregate in cement composites on

2021.4.1  Note that the aggregate crushing value of the bauxite aggregate (8.0%) is much smaller than that of the granite aggregate (32.7%), which is consistent with that reported in Ref. [1]. For coarse aggregate, a higher aggregate crushing value generally corresponds to a lower compressive strength (Fig. 1). It is thus reasonable to assume

Bauxite: The principal ore of aluminum. - Geology

Bauxite is the primary ore of aluminum. Almost all of the aluminum that has ever been produced has been extracted from bauxite. The United States has a few small bauxite deposits but at least 99% of the bauxite used in the United States is imported. The United States is also a major importer of aluminum metal.
